[PATCH v2 2/2] clk: st: clkgen-mux: search reg within node or parent

Stephen Boyd sboyd at kernel.org
Wed Jan 5 17:22:05 PST 2022


Quoting Alain Volmat (2021-12-18 13:11:57)
> In order to avoid having duplicated addresses within the DT,
> only have one unit-address per clockgen and each driver within
> the clockgen should look at the parent node (overall clockgen)
> to figure out the reg property.  Such behavior is already in
> place in other STi platform clock drivers such as clk-flexgen
> and clkgen-pll.  Keep backward compatibility by first looking
> at reg within the node before looking into the parent node.
